Content Creation: Brainstorm and draft compelling copy for our social media channels (X/Twitter, Instagram, Facebook, TikTok).
Community Management: Engage directly with our users by responding to comments, running polls, and participating in conversations online. You'll be the voice of HitchPay!
Campaign Support: Assist in the execution of marketing campaigns, from "Flash Offers" and quizzes to user feedback sessions.
Content Calendar Management: Help plan and schedule our social media content using tools like Zoho Social.
Market Research: Keep a close eye on what our competitors are doing and identify new trends, memes, and content formats that we can leverage.
Performance Tracking: Learn how to track and report on key marketing metrics, like engagement rates, reach, and follower growth.
Collaboration: Work with our Media Production Manager to create briefs for short-form videos and other creative assets.
Eligibility: Must be a recent graduate, a current NYSC member, or a university student seeking an Industrial Training (IT) placement.
Passion for Social Media: You are a power user of platforms like X/Twitter, Instagram, and TikTok. You understand what makes content engaging and shareable.
Excellent Communication Skills: You have strong writing and verbal communication skills. You can write clean, witty, and error-free copy.
Creative Mindset: You are full of ideas and are not afraid to suggest new and unconventional ways to engage an audience.
Proactive & Eager to Learn: You have a "can-do" attitude, are highly organized, and are genuinely excited to learn about fintech, marketing, and startups.
